It’s common for managers to begin their employee alert system deployment with a search for text alert systems. After all, it is the most popular mode, That’s how most of our customers find us. However, text alone will not cover every person not every scenario. First, not everyone has access to SMS. Given that, you need to have your bases covered with other modes. There are accessibility issues that may be better covered with Voice of Email.
Also, consider our article “Spamming via SMS“. Yes, this is a real thing! You may have a legitimate issue that needs to be highlighted that is not quite important enough to bother 250 people who might be on vacation, in heavy traffic, or at the dinner table. This is where email is important. When we point that out, we often hear that “we already have that for the office, and most of the people out in the shop don’t have email addresses” Well of course they do, and they need to be collected as part of system deployment. Not only that, a good percentage of AMG Alerts customers use our system occasionally to broadcast information about outages of their email systems, so collection of everyone’s personal email address is always beneficial, as a good system can toggle back and forth between business and personal email.
Therefore, an adequate system should include comprehensive email, text, and voice. We add web to that, because there are instances where an employee may feel he/she should have received a message and has not, and thus becomes anxious. His they are able to check for messages on demand, that problem is averted.
We always suggest that ALL modes need to be carefully considered at the outset. Nobody wants to have to “start over” in their deployment of an employee alert system.
